breeze a light or gentle wind.
earth the third planet from the sun.
enormous very large in size or amount; huge.
fellow belonging to the same group, having the same job, or sharing the same interests.
few only a small number of.
gap a space or opening between two things.
gift something a person gives without wanting anything in return; a present.
horror a strong feeling of fear or shock.
page one side of a sheet of printed or written paper.
pocket a small piece of material that is open at the top and sewn onto clothing for holding things.
ray1 a thin beam of light.
skate to move over ice or another hard surface using shoes that have a blade or wheels attached to the bottom.
tent a shelter held up by poles and rope and made of cloth or plastic.
thump a heavy, dull sound of one thing hitting another.
writer a person whose job is to create books, articles, poems, or other materials; author.
